设计与开发

单片机 投币 AVR单片机系列教程(一)

小编 2024-10-06 设计与开发 23 0

AVR单片机系列教程(一)

一、基础篇

单片机的基本要素:

(1)CPU核(如:51核 AVR核 M430核)

(2)ROM(READ ONLY Memory 绕母)

(3)RAM(random access Memory 随机访问寄存器 )

(4)片上外设

(5)总线

CPU核: 相当于电脑的CPU吧、就是执行从ROM中取指令。这东西有几个指标非常重要

一、主频(如51核是2MHZ晶振12分频过来就是2MHZ、AVR 是20MHZ(快达到DSP水平了)MSP430F1系列的是8MHZ)

二、指令集 (CISC(复杂) RISC(精简)当然精简指令集比复杂执行效率高很多个人觉得缺点实现的功能少 )

三、字长 (就是一次能处理二进制数据的位数 我们单片机一般是8位 16位 AVR和51都是8位)

ROM: 相当于电脑的硬盘、存储程序用的指标就是容量 大多数是flash 结构基本都混淆说了

一、容量 单位一般KB位单位

二、高级指标 、自编能力(就是程序在运行中可以自己擦出flash然后更改flash中的内容的能力一般我们用不到)

如:51(不具备自编能力)-->8KB

MSP430F1101(具备)--> 1KB

AVR(具备)---> 16KB

RAM: 数据存储器、相当于计算机的内存、ROM中的程序在运行时快速的存取数据、目前大多数单

片机为SRAM结构 计算机室SDRAM结构。指标也是容量 一般 B(字节) KB(千字节)

一、容量 、

如: 51单片机512字节

MSP430F1101 128字节

AVR 1KB 1千字节

主要是程序运行时调用一些变量啊调用一些数组等都是存在RAM中的。

片上外设: 相当于电脑的接口,鼠标接口、显示器接口等

常见的片上外设模块有外部中断、定时器/计数器、URAT(异步串行)、SPI(同步)IIC(2线的串行口)ADC及模拟比较器等。

如:一下三种价格10元左右的单片机

一、89C52就只有外部中断 定时器计数器 UART

二、MSP430F1101 外部中断 定时器计数器 ADC

三、AVR 外部中断、定时器/计数器、URAT(异步串行)、SPI(同步串行)IIC(2线的串行口)ADC及模拟比较器。

总线: 用于以上四部分之间的传输数据的通道、相当于硬盘的IDE线、光驱线等。

总线只是一个概念。没有一个实际的这样的一个东西、这个东西我也不太清楚可以理解为一束功能相近的导线的集合吧。

单片机能做什么?

单片机无所不能!

所谓的“微电脑控制控制”的核心就是单片机(微电脑控制比较时髦的)覆盖工业生产、日常生活、军事设备、科研仪表仪器等所有智能化的应用场合

例如:智能洗衣机(一般洗衣机不能完成的功能)

定时完成洗衣脱水功能。

可以判断衣服的干净程度。

实现洗净既停的功能。

蒸汽熨烫的功能。

刷卡投币洗衣

更加智能LG公司的"IPAD"洗衣机一边洗衣一边听歌。

例如:(LED显示屏)

LED发光二极管构成显示屏的像素点

单片机负责逐点火逐行扫描,并与电脑通信获取图片信息。

例如:(PH/ORP仪表)

用于环境监测、工矿企业、科学研究、水产养殖等场合的PH值的测定

读取PH传感器的模拟信号、内部处理后显示在LCD上。(其实就是读取液体的PH值)

还有很多数码产品。。。

还有智能小车(我上大学时就做过这样一个东西呵呵用ATMEGA8)

一、巡线

二、避障

三、电视机遥控器遥控(接受各个遥控器的键码)

四、LCD显示

了解更多AVR单片机系列,可关注“云汉电子社区(ickeybbs) ”官方微信公众号,或者登录云汉电子社区官方网站(bbs.ickey.cn)

小七灵兽|你知道自动售货机是如何识别硬币的吗?

现代意义上的自动售货机诞生了几十年,在中国已经有近20年的历史,它的普及也是近几年的事情。那么你知道自动售货机是如何识别硬币的吗?硬币的面额和真伪的鉴定是一个非常复杂的过程,让我们揭开这个秘密。

自动售货机中的硬币识别模块主要由电路板、硬币滑槽和硬币分类器组成,是很精确的仪器。当你把一枚硬币放进自动售货机时,硬币先经过两组光传感器,这两组光传感器测量硬币的直径。LED发光器件和光接收传感器组成光传感器,LED发出的光将被对面的光接收传感器接收。

当硬币通过传感器时,它会挡住光线,控制电路板将计算硬币阻挡光线的时间以及两组传感器之间的时间差,然后可以测量硬币的直径。一元硬币的直径比5毛硬币大,而且阻挡传感器发出的光需要更长的时间。此外,光学传感器可以精确测量硬币的直径,判断硬币是否流通,这是鉴别真伪的第一步。真币采用钢芯镀镍工艺,具有特殊的电磁特性。特别设计的高频振荡电路能有效区分金属材料的电磁阻抗,进一步甄别其真实性。

金属切削时磁力线会感应电流,而电流会产生磁场,根据磁电互转换原理,当铜线圈有电流时,它就会变成电磁铁,形成固定的磁场。当硬币通过时,它会切断磁场,然后改变铜线圈中的电流。

另外,不同的金属成分对铜线圈的磁场有不同的影响,单片机根据铜线圈中感应电流的变化,确定不同金属元件对应的硬币。

只要硬币通过上述两个识别装置,自动售货机就能在不到一秒钟的时间内感应到硬币的面值,然后将其引导到相应的投币口,从而实现按面值分类存放。当然,也有的识别装置无法识别真币的情况,但是概率很低,这种情况会把硬币重新退回硬币口。

自动售货机向电子支付方向发展是一大趋势,也许在不久的将来,基于硬币的支付将被完全淘汰,因为新的面部支付有太多的优势,你可以不用拿手机买东西,方便又快捷,也不用再担心买东西手机没电的情况发生了。

小7智能售卖机 是小七灵兽旗下产品,是一台集合了AI视觉识别、物联网等科技为一体的高颜值新零售终端盒子,便捷购物、数字化运营、24小时无人零售、产品超高性价比等优点获得了众多粉丝喜爱。为办公室、公寓楼、运动场所、众创空间、服务行业等室内半开放场所的客户带来即拿即走的无人零售体验。

上图为小七灵兽旗下的小7智能售卖机

上图为小七灵兽专为女性开发的的小7粉红智能柜

小七灵兽 是一家专注于零售行业的智能科技、数字化重塑;服务于快消、日用日化、生鲜果蔬、玩具文具、文创饰品等行业,打造并提供“Ai云计算+智能商家+数据决策”S2B2C 生态系统和数字化运营体系服务,“零售数字化解决方案、新零售全场景运营服务、数字化商学院”三大服务生态赋能企业智慧零售运营和商业创新,驱动企业数字化转型。目前,小七灵兽“S2B2C 生态系统数字云解决方案”已获众多行业客户认可,并为多家企业成功实现零售数字化转型与增长。公司在北京、南昌、深圳、东莞设立研发及分支机构,为企业零售数字化转型提供全链路服务支持和安全保障。

相关问答

自动售卖机原理?

二、自动售货机的核心是单片机。自动售货机有自己专用的通讯协议,欧美系列为“MDB”,日韩系列为“VCCS”。主控制板、纸币识别器、硬币管理器(识别接收、...

猜你喜欢